TCS iON Goes Green, Commissions First Solar Rooftop Project

Aims to transform 251 centres to solar empowered zones which will help saving more than 25% of TCS iON Digital Zone’s total electricity consumption across the country.

Strategic unit of Tata Consultancy Services,TCS iON has recently commenced an initiative to transform its Digital Zones into clean energy efficient Green Zones.In this regard,TCS iON commissioned its first solar power rooftop project at Ram Ganga Vihar in Moradabad, Uttar Pradesh.

As part this mission, TCS iON aims to transform its 251 owned centres to solar empowered zones which will help in saving more than 25 percent of its Digital Zone’s total electricity consumption across the country.Indeed a step towards reducing the carbon footprint for preserving resources for current and future generations.

Clean energy drive

Venguswamy Ramaswamy, Global Head, TCS iON stated that TCS iON took a leap by establishing paperless assessments through our Digital centres, saving approximately 17, 85, 000 trees till date.They now take another step to optimize energy consumption and identify methods to utilize renewable energy for these centres to be empowered with cutting edge energy consumption practices and are deploying IoT based monitoring methods under this initiative.

TCS iON conducts more than 85 percent of the large-scale and high-stake academic and recruitment examinations in India through its state-of-the-art infrastructure across 625 cities through its ‘Phygital’ platforms.

The TCS iON Digital Zone at Ram Ganga Vihar, Moradabad alone has 532 computing nodes with the capacity of assessing 2000 candidates a day. This zone, which went live on May 10, 2016, has conducted more than 435 exams and assessed 2,25,000 candidates till date.
